    Not really, the 9000 and 4MX 440 perform about the samee in the PB's and the 7500 and 4MX 420 about the same in the iBook and 12"



    OpenGl and those directX benches you read about are 2 different things on the mac and PC alike.



    Also, I believe the new nVidia cards are on some sort of mini-package module, not user upgradeable, but much easier for Apple to swap in/out during production. I think Apple will contiue to use both for a better cost availability position since ther performance difference is negligible.



    If they supply the 9600, expect it to be a high-end option, and they ought to consider going with a full 128MB too, given that many PB's might be asked to drive 1920+ display widths plus their own internal display.
